What is a Registered Trading Company in South Africa?
A registered trading company is a legal entity distinct from its owners, with the ability to conduct various commercial activities and enter into contracts. By registering a trading company, individuals or groups of individuals can enhance their business’s credibility, stability, and growth potential.
Benefits of Registering a Trading Company in South Africa
Embarking on the path of registering a trading company in South Africa unlocks a treasure trove of benefits that can empower your business in countless ways:
- Limited liability: The most compelling advantage of forming a trading company is the concept of limited liability. Shareholders are not personally liable for any debts or liabilities incurred by the company, offering a crucial layer of financial protection for business owners.
- Tax optimization: Registered trading companies are subject to corporate tax rates, which can often be more favorable compared to individual income tax rates. This tax efficiency can translate into substantial savings and increased profitability for your business.
- Enhanced credibility: A registered trading company exudes an air of professionalism and legitimacy, instantly enhancing your company’s image in the eyes of clients, investors, and suppliers.
- Increased borrowing capacity: Lenders often view registered trading companies as more stable and reliable entities, increasing your access to capital and unlocking opportunities for business expansion.
- Business continuity: Unlike proprietorships or partnerships, a registered trading company enjoys perpetual succession, ensuring the continuity of your business regardless of changes in ownership or management.
- Increased transparency and accountability: Trading companies are required to maintain thorough financial records and comply with regulatory requirements, fostering greater transparency and accountability within your organization.

Types of Registered Trading Companies in South Africa
South African legislation provides various types of registered trading companies to cater to different business needs:
- Private company (Pty Ltd): The most common type of trading company, offering limited liability and a flexible structure.
- Public company (Ltd): Designed for larger businesses, public companies allow shares to be traded on the stock exchange.
- Non-profit company (NPC): Formed for charitable or social purposes, NPC’s operate without profit-making intentions.
- Close corporation (CC): A hybrid structure that combines limited liability with the flexibility of a partnership.
